Zcash Leads the Privacy-First Movement

Zcash continues to set the standard for privacy-focused digital assets through its use of zero‑knowledge proofs (ZK‑SNARKs), allowing users to shield transaction details without compromising security. Earlier this month, ZEC rallied sharply amid growing institutional interest and the launch of new privacy features like shielded cross-chain swaps. However, after reaching a four-year high, the asset has entered a correction phase, with recent price action showing signs of weakening momentum.

This volatility highlights a key theme in privacy-driven assets: while demand for secure, confidential transactions is increasing, the path forward remains unpredictable. Even so, Zcash’s role in pioneering on-chain privacy keeps it central to the broader conversation about privacy in digital assets.

Aster: Infrastructure for Confidential DeFi

Aster is advancing the privacy narrative with a purpose-built Layer 1 blockchain designed for confidentiality. The Aster Chain leverages zero-knowledge technology to enable on-chain trading that protects sensitive data, making it ideal for both individuals and institutions. With sub-second finality, low gas fees, and automated cross-chain execution, Aster is positioning itself as the technical backbone for privacy-enabled, high-frequency DeFi.

Its beta platform supports confidential trading through off-chain execution combined with trustless settlement. This structure ensures users benefit from both strong privacy and operational efficiency. Aster’s model reflects a broader trend: privacy-first infrastructure is becoming a defining characteristic of next-generation blockchain platforms.

Ethereum’s Kohaku Roadmap Pushes Privacy Mainstream

Ethereum is also prioritizing privacy through its newly launched Kohaku roadmap. Developed by the Ethereum Foundation’s Privacy Cluster, this initiative brings together 47 top engineers, researchers, and cryptographers to integrate advanced privacy features across the Ethereum ecosystem.

Kohaku introduces a modular, open-source SDK designed to embed privacy directly into wallets and decentralized applications. Key features include private transactions, IP address masking, app-level data isolation, and zero-knowledge-based security. The roadmap signals Ethereum’s long-term commitment to making privacy a first-class property of its protocol.

Why Privacy in Digital Assets Matters

    • Financial Sovereignty: Privacy allows users to protect their accounts, avoid censorship, and fully control their financial activity.
    • Security: Concealing wallet balances and transaction history reduces vulnerability to targeted attacks and data exposure.
    • Institutional Confidence: Enterprises require privacy to safeguard strategic operations and meet internal compliance mandates before moving on-chain.
    • Regulatory Compatibility: Modern privacy tools enable users to prove identity or compliance without revealing underlying activity, offering a pathway to regulatory trust.
    • DeFi Innovation: As DeFi matures, privacy becomes essential to protect trading strategies, unlock deeper liquidity, and support more complex financial products.
